Responsibilities

GENERAL SUMMARY OF J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

The Senior Network Engineer plays a key role in designing, implementing, and supporting enterprise network infrastructure. This role includes hands-on configuration of networking hardware, troubleshooting advanced issues, and ensuring availability and performance across LAN/WAN environments. The Senior Network Engineer collaborates with IT and security teams to ensure network solutions are secure, scalable, and aligned with business needs.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Participate in planning and execution of disaster recovery strategies.
  • Conduct network performance tuning, capacity planning, and fault analysis.
  • Document configurations, network diagrams, and standard operating procedures.
  • Mentor junior engineers and provide escalation support for complex issues.
  • Evaluate and deploy new network tools and technologies to improve operations.
  • Provide input to network strategy and roadmaps.
  • Design and implement network solutions to meet business and technical requirements.
  • Configure and manage routing and switching protocols, firewalls, VPNs, and wireless systems.
